This print showcases a remarkable piece of art titled "Concert 1774 Etching engraving first state three" from the Liszt Collection. The image, expertly captured by Artokoloro, transports us back to the vibrant world of 18th-century Paris. The etching engraving, created by Antoine Jean Duclos after Augustin de Saint-Aubin, offers a glimpse into a lively concert scene that took place in 1774. The intricate details and masterful technique employed in this artwork are truly awe-inspiring. Measuring approximately 11 1/8 x 16 7/16 inches (283 x 418 cm), this print allows us to appreciate every nuance and delicate stroke made by the artist's hand.
